Bariatric Equipment Market size was valued at USD 3.1 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 5.5 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 7.3% from 2024 to 2030.
The United States bariatric equipment market has seen substantial growth due to an increasing awareness of obesity and the need for specialized medical equipment. These devices are designed to cater to the needs of individuals who are overweight or obese, providing solutions that improve both comfort and healthcare outcomes. The market can be segmented into two major categories based on application: commercial and household. Both segments offer unique opportunities for companies to address the rising demand for bariatric solutions. As the population continues to age and the prevalence of obesity increases, the demand for bariatric equipment in both commercial and household settings is expected to continue its upward trajectory.

The commercial bariatric equipment market primarily includes devices used in healthcare facilities, such as hospitals, clinics, and rehabilitation centers. These pieces of equipment are designed to accommodate larger individuals in settings that require high standards of safety and comfort. Key products in this segment include bariatric beds, wheelchairs, lifts, and seating. These devices are engineered to provide greater weight capacity, improved durability, and enhanced functionality to ensure proper patient care. The growing demand for these commercial products is closely linked to the rising rates of obesity, which is contributing to an increased need for healthcare services that cater to this demographic. Furthermore, hospitals and healthcare providers are increasingly investing in bariatric equipment to meet patient needs while ensuring the best possible care outcomes. As the healthcare industry evolves, the commercial segment of the bariatric equipment market is anticipated to expand, driven by technological advancements and the need for more specialized equipment in patient care facilities.
The household bariatric equipment market caters to individuals in residential settings who require specialized products to improve their quality of life. This segment includes products such as bariatric mobility aids, chairs, beds, and other assistive devices that are specifically designed to support individuals who are overweight or obese in their daily activities. As obesity rates continue to rise across the U.S., there is a growing demand for household equipment that helps individuals maintain independence while ensuring their comfort and safety. Many bariatric equipment providers are focusing on designing products that are not only practical but also aesthetically pleasing to better integrate into a home environment. The increasing awareness of obesity-related health issues and the push for a healthier lifestyle is driving growth in the household segment, creating new opportunities for companies to offer innovative, user-friendly solutions to meet this growing need. These products help individuals navigate their homes with greater ease, contributing to their overall well-being and quality of life.
One of the key trends in the bariatric equipment market is the growing focus on technological innovation. Companies are increasingly integrating smart technologies into bariatric devices, such as pressure sensors, adjustable features, and monitoring systems, which help optimize the user experience and improve safety. For example, bariatric beds equipped with pressure-relieving features and advanced electronic controls are becoming more common in both commercial and household settings. These technological advancements are making bariatric equipment more effective and user-friendly, leading to better outcomes for individuals and healthcare providers alike.
Another key trend is the increasing emphasis on customization and personalization in bariatric equipment. As the demand for bariatric solutions continues to rise, manufacturers are focusing on offering products that can be tailored to the specific needs of individual users. This trend is particularly noticeable in the development of bariatric chairs, wheelchairs, and mobility aids, where features such as adjustable seat widths, armrests, and backrests allow for a more personalized fit. Customization ensures that the equipment is not only comfortable but also optimally functional for each user’s unique body size and shape.

1. What is bariatric equipment?
Bariatric equipment refers to medical and assistive devices designed to accommodate individuals who are overweight or obese, offering support and comfort in daily activities.
2. What products are included in the bariatric equipment market?
The bariatric equipment market includes products such as bariatric beds, wheelchairs, mobility aids, chairs, lifts, and seating solutions.
3. Why is the demand for bariatric equipment increasing?
The increasing rates of obesity, especially in the United States, are driving the demand for specialized bariatric equipment for both healthcare facilities and home use.
4. What is the role of bariatric equipment in healthcare settings?
Bariatric equipment in healthcare settings helps ensure the comfort, safety, and proper care of overweight and obese patients, improving patient outcomes.
5. How does bariatric equipment benefit individuals in household settings?
Bariatric equipment in households helps individuals maintain independence, mobility, and comfort while carrying out daily activities in a safe manner.
6. What are some examples of bariatric household equipment?
Examples of bariatric household equipment include bariatric chairs, mobility aids, beds, and seating solutions tailored to accommodate larger body sizes.
7. What are the key trends in the bariatric equipment market?
Key trends include technological innovations, customization of products, and a focus on improving user experience and safety.
8. How does technology impact the bariatric equipment market?
Technology enhances bariatric equipment by integrating features like pressure sensors, adjustable settings, and monitoring systems for improved comfort and safety.
9. What opportunities exist in the bariatric equipment market?
Opportunities include catering to the aging population, expanding home healthcare solutions, and developing personalized bariatric products to meet individual needs.
10. What are the challenges in the bariatric equipment market?
Challenges include the high cost of equipment, the need for continuous innovation, and the difficulty in designing products that meet the diverse needs of bariatric patients.
